Edward Elgar ... hota ola hoyHandel's four coronation anthems use text from the King James Bible and were originally commissioned for the coronation of George II in 1727, but have become standard for later coronations. They are Zadok the Priest, Let Thy Hand Be Strengthened, The King Shall Rejoice, and My Heart Is Inditing.
